DFIs' Clean Oceans Initiative hits €1.3bn in financing

In:
Infrastructure, Waste and water
Region:
Middle East & Africa, Americas, Asia-Pacific, Europe

The Agence Francaise de Developpement, the European Investment Bank, and Germany's KfW have reported significant progress on the Clean Oceans Initiative - which aims to finance €2 billion in public and private sector projects by 2023.The initiative identifies projects that reduce discharge...
